Engineering and Specifications
Factory-optioned sport shocks give the chassis a more purposeful character, supporting disciplined body control and confident responses through flowing corners and rapid directional changes. Four-wheel disc brakes provide substantial stopping capability, and service completed in 2023 reportedly included overhauled calipers, stainless-steel brake lines, fresh fluid, replacement pads, and new rotors. The 16-inch Fuchs alloy wheels wear Firestone Firehawk Indy 500 tires with 2022 date codes, measuring 205/55 at the front and 225/50 at the rear.
